Transaction 3f3257779ef570984fd1cd228345e05fe4e8761c6f80b2177df8de8882abc29a

23 Input
1 Outputs
  • 3f3257779ef570984fd1cd228345e05fe4e8761c6f80b2177df8de8882abc29a:0
  • value  31120192036
    address  1LyiZuWyhsmrGd7MacPdGjCNbU2DqjEskC